Sami Tajeddine
(Redirected from Tajeddine Sami)
Sami Tajeddine (born 10 June 1982) is a Moroccan football player who, as of 2004[update], was playing for Raja Casablanca.
He was part of the Moroccan 2004 Olympic football team, who exited in the first round, finishing third in group D, behind group winners Iraq and runners-up Costa Rica.[1]
